使用MySQLDocker设置Jira

了解如何使用MySQLdocker设置Jira。

大家好,

隔了很久,我又来了。我有一些新的和有趣的东西。在本文中,我们将在主机上设置一个基于JiraDataCenter/Server的实例。

先决条件

安装最新版本的Jira。下载Jira软件服务器。在此演示中,我使用了JiraSoftware9.1.0和tar.gz存档分发。您还可以下载基于zip的发行版。我更喜欢这些,因为它们大多与平台无关。提取它。

应该安装Docker。

现在让我们开始演示。我正在使用mac进行此演示。

我们将首先创建一个自定义的mysql选项文件my-custom.conf。我通过以下方式创建了文件。

$pwd/Users/cpandey/Docker$catmysql-conf/jiramysql/conf.d/my-custom.conf[mysqld]default-storage-engine=INNODBcharacter_set_server=utf8mb4innodb_default_row_format=DYNAMICinnodb_log_file_size=2Gsql_mode=NO_AUTO_VALUE_ON_ZERO

现在我将运行以下docker命令来运行MySQLdocker映像。这里重要的一点是,作为卷,我提供my-custom.conf作为MySQL选项文件,并提供mysql-data作为主机中的文件夹名称,以便它保留MySQL数据。我已将容器名称设置为jiramysql。

$dockerpullmysql$sudodockerrun--detach--name=jiramysql--env="MYSQL_ROOT_PASSWORD=password"--publish:--volume=/Users/cpandey/Development/Docker/mysql-data:/var/lib/mysql--volume=/Users/cpandey/Development/Docker/mysql-conf/jiramysql/conf.d:/etc/mysql/conf.dmysql$sudodockerpsCONTAINERIDIMAGECOMMANDCREATEDSTATUSPORTSNAMESe16fe72d3be3mysql"docker-entrypoint.s…"9minutesagoUp9minutes0/tcp,0.0.0.0:-/tcp,:::-/tcpjiramysql7ecf80fa4cafpostgres:latest"docker-entrypoint.s…"4weeksagoUp27minutes0.0.0.0:-/tcp,:::-/tcppostgres1$sudodockerexec-itjiramysqlbashbash-4.4#mysql-uroot-ppasswordmysql:[Warning]Usingapasswordonthe


转载请注明:http://www.aierlanlan.com/rzdk/4741.html